Where is congressional district CO-7?

Congressional District CO-7 includes 61 indexable ZIP codes in Colorado on US5, with a combined ZIP-area population of about 721,477.

Larger population clusters inside this district include Lakewood, CO, Arvada, CO, Broomfield, CO, Dakota Ridge, CO, and Golden, CO. Open any ZIP below for full demographics, housing, schools, and nearby services.

The most populous ZIP currently listed for CO-7 is 80020 (about 53,589 residents).

Income and housing in CO-7

Across ZIPs with income data in CO-7, the average median household income is about $90,361 — about 20% above the U.S. median ($75,149).

Average median home value across those ZIPs is about $495,380.

On this page’s income ranking, ZIP 80454 is near the top at about $173,125.

What is a U.S. House district?

Congressional districts are the geographic units that elect members of the U.S. House of Representatives. District CO-7 is one of Colorado's seats in the House; boundaries are redrawn after each decennial Census.

District lines are not the same as ZIP codes, cities, counties, area codes, or TV markets. A single ZIP can touch more than one district at the edges, and US5 maps each published ZIP to a primary district code for browseability.
